Directions: Use only as directed. Take 1 VegCap twice daily with a meal or glass of water.
Ingredients: 1 Vegetarian Capsule supplies:
Japanese Knotweed (Polygonum cuspidatum) (root/rhizome extract) (Guaranteed 30 mg [40%] Total
Resveratrol and 15 mg [20%] Transresveratrol) 75 mg
Grape (skin extract) (Guaranteed 20 mg [20%] Polyphenols) 100 mg
Grape (Vitis vinifera) (seed extract) (Guaranteed 47.5 mg [95%] Polyphenols, including Oligomeric Proanthocyanidins [OPC]) 50 mg
Red Wine Extract 25 mg
Other Ingredients: Cellulose, Vegetable Cellulose Capsule, Organic Rice Extract Blend, Silica and Maltodextrin (from Non-GMO Corn).
Warning: Keep out of reach of children. Keep your licensed health care practitioner informed when using this product. Do not use if you are pregnant.

Resveratrol is a powerful antioxidant that helps protect cells from damage caused by free radicals. This can help reduce inflammation and lower the risk of chronic diseases.
Resveratrol may help improve heart health by reducing inflammation, lowering blood pressure, and improving circulation. It may also help lower LDL cholesterol levels.
Some studies suggest that resveratrol may help protect brain cells from damage and improve cognitive function. It may also have potential benefits for conditions like Alzheimer's disease.
Resveratrol has been linked to potential anti-aging effects, including promoting longevity and reducing the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ines.
Research indicates that resveratrol may have anti-cancer properties by inhibiting the growth of cancer cells and promoting their death. It may also help prevent the spread of cancer.

Resveratrol is a popular supplement known for its antioxidant properties and potential health benefits. If you are looking for an alternative to Resveratrol 75 mg, you may consider the following option:
Curcumin is a compound found in turmeric that has been studied for its an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. It is known for its potential health benefits, including supporting joint health, brain function, and overall well-being.
You can find Curcumin supplements in various strengths, with recommended dosages depending on your specific health goals and needs.
When choosing a Curcumin supplement, look for reputable brands that use high-quality ingredients and have good customer reviews.
